My wife picked up some of the black elmers board today. She had me build deviders in a couple of decorative boxes. Afterwards I messed around and started experimenting with it. I forgot about how you mentioned it warping. Do you put the minwax on the back "papered" side, or over the exposed foam to prevent the warp? Cause it seemed to want to warp as soon as I took it out of water and removed the paper. I was only working with a 5x5 inch piece and can see it cause problems with a larger piece.

As far as the minwax, I've been applying it to both sides before painting, it soaks into the paper and makes it VERY sturdy but also seems to stiffen the foam considerably. The Elmer's board removing the paper seems much more difficult than the Dollar Tree board. |

Corner caps! bought some corner molding at Home Depot, 88 cents per foot comes in a 12 foot piece, cut it in half at the store so it would fit in my car. Brought it home cut the first piece and threw some gray paint on it. I think it's going to work!
